What is Grey Water?

Grey water refers to wastewater generated from sinks, showers, bathtubs, washing machines, and other household appliances that do not produce fecal matter or urine. This type of wastewater is relatively clean compared to blackwater (toilet waste) and can be safely reused for irrigation, toilet flushing, and even cleaning.

How Does a Grey Water System Work?

A grey water system collects and treats wastewater from the aforementioned sources, then reuses it for various purposes within your home or yard. The process typically involves:

  1. Collection: Wastewater is collected from sinks, showers, bathtubs, washing machines, and other appliances via a network of pipes.
  2. Treatment: The collected grey water passes through a treatment system that removes contaminants, sediment, and other impurities.
  3. Reuse: Treated grey water is then reused for irrigation, toilet flushing, or other non-potable purposes.

Benefits of Grey Water Systems

Grey water systems offer numerous benefits for homeowners and the environment:

  • Water Conservation: By reusing grey water, you can significantly reduce your water consumption and lower your utility bills.
  • Reduced Pressure on Sewer Systems: With a grey water system in place, you can divert wastewater from your household appliances, reducing the load on municipal sewer systems.
  • Sustainable Landscaping: Treated grey water can be used for irrigation, promoting healthy plant growth and reducing your reliance on potable water for outdoor landscaping needs.

Installing a Grey Water System

While installing a grey water system requires some investment, it's an attractive option for homeowners who:

  • Live in areas with water restrictions
  • Have large gardens or lawns
  • Are committed to sustainability and reducing their environmental footprint

When selecting a grey water system, consider the following factors:

  • Space requirements: Ensure your home has sufficient space for the treatment tank and other components.
  • Budget: Grey water systems can vary in cost, so set a budget before making a final decision.
  • Regulations: Check with local authorities to determine if grey water systems are allowed in your area.
